Shadcn UI

shadcn/ui 是一个基于 Radix UI 和 Tailwind CSS 构建的可复用组件集合,它提供了一套美观、可定制且易于使用的 UI 组件,开发者可以直接复制粘贴到项目中使用,无需安装依赖 。

收录时间:
2025-05-10
Shadcn UIShadcn UI

Shadcn UI 是一个面向现代 Web 开发的 React 组件库,以简洁的设计语言、高效的开发体验和良好的可维护性为核心特点。该库基于 Radix UI 提供的无障碍原语与 Tailwind CSS 的原子化样式体系构建,适用于对界面一致性与工程效率有较高要求的开发场景。

Shadcn UI官网入口网址:https://ui.shadcn.com

Shadcn UI插图

组件库涵盖按钮、表单控件、导航菜单、数据表格等常用 UI 元素,所有组件均采用模块化设计,支持按需引入。开发者可在 Next.js、Vite、Remix 等主流框架中直接集成,并通过清晰的文档快速完成配置与定制。

高度可定制的主题系统

Shadcn UI 内置主题编辑器,允许用户实时调整配色方案、圆角大小、字体比例等视觉参数,并支持亮色与暗色模式的动态切换。预设的多套主题可直接复用,配合一键复制代码功能,显著减少重复性样式开发工作。

注重可访问性与开放性

所有组件遵循 WAI-ARIA 规范,确保在不同设备和辅助技术下具备良好的可用性。项目采用 MIT 开源许可证,代码完全开放,允许自由使用、修改及分发。此外,其结构化的组件定义也为 AI 工具解析与生成 UI 代码提供了良好基础。

Shadcn UI 适合希望在保证设计质量的同时提升前端开发效率的团队或个人使用,尤其适用于需要快速搭建高保真原型或构建长期维护型产品的项目。

相关导航